Health Insurance Explained – The YouToons Have It Covered
Millions of us now have health insurance below the Affordable Care Act, or what some people call Obamacare. But later many things in life, your health insurance can often be unclear and complicated. Whether you've been insured for years or you're further to the game, concord your policy is important to your health and your wallet. First things first, you have to pay your premium every month or your insurance could get cancelled - nice of subsequent to your cable subscription. You can along with think of it gone a shared health care piggy bank -- we every chip in each month, even if we're healthy, so the grant is there afterward we obsession it. If you acquire insurance at work, your employer probably pays most of your premium and the burning comes out of your paycheck automatically. If you have Medicaid, you most likely don't have to pay any premium at all -- the federal government and your acknowledge understand care of that.

To enlarged your odds at staying healthy, be clear to give a positive response advantage of the clear preventive services that all other insurance plans provide. But of course...stuff happens. And that's when insurance in point of fact comes in handy. Now, having insurance helps a lot, but it doesn't aspire every your health care is going to be free. There are lots of details virtually your insurance plot that pretense how much you pay later you get ill or injured.
If you have Medicaid, a lot of these services could utterly without difficulty be free. Otherwise, you'll likely have to pay something later you go to the doctor or fill a prescription. This is called a copay gone it's a specific dollar amount -- when $25 per visit... or coinsurance if it's a percentage of the bill. There's with the deductible -- that's how much comes out of your own pocket since your insurance starts paying. Depending on your plan, you might have a deductible for every your care, or it might deserted apply to some types of care, afterward hospital stays and prescriptions.
So admission your plot material, because it can rule into the thousands of dollars! other important share of your plot is the out of pocket maximum.
This is the most you'll ever have to pay in any one year. At least for the help your plot covers. Your insurer will pay 100% of anything over the maximum for the blazing of the year. It can be just as hazy dealing subsequently prescriptions! Your plot has a list of drugs it will pay for, called a formulary, but the prices vary.
Check in the same way as your doctor or pharmacist, because a generic drug might repair you taking place the thesame as a brand state drug, but the price difference could be huge. So, those are the costs typically involved, but recall that they'll be affected by your insurance plan's provider network. This is a list of doctors and hospitals that are connected to your plan.
Insurance companies negotiate discounts bearing in mind these providers. Stay in-network, and the discounts acquire passed to you. o out of network, and you could stop stirring paying full price. And recall that out-of-pocket limit? It won't sham if you go out of network! In some plans -- bearing in mind HMOs or EPOs -- your insurance would pay nothing if you go out-of-network. In new plans -- later than PPOs -- your insurance will lid you no issue where you go, but you'll pay a lot more if you go out of network.
Also, if you desire to visit a specialist - later an orthopedist - some plans require a referral from your primary care doctor. sealed simple enough? Well, sometimes staying in-network can be tricky! In a hospital, it's reachable that your surgeon could be in-network, even if your anesthesiologist is not. Don't be afraid to negotiate taking into account your provider or file an pull behind your insurer. suitably as you can see, there's a lot to think nearly like you pick an insurance plot each year. Some plans may have low premiums, but fewer doctors or hospitals and high deductibles. There are tradeoffs, and covenant and choosing in the midst of plans isn't always easy.
